Shrubs of Wisconsin

Salix humilis Marshall
prairie willow
Family: Salicaceae
shrub branch leaves male aments female aments
 

Salix humilis is usually a low, much-branched shrub of dry habitats. It is not restricted to prairies, but rather is found on a variety of dry, sunny sites. It is found throughout the state, but is most common in the areas of sandy soils.
